Comfort Zone® Digital Electric Oil Filled Radiator Heater features a digital interface with soft touch push button controls, with on/off power indicator light; display can be set to Fahrenheit or Celsius readouts. Timer function turns heater on/off in 1 hour increments for up to 10 hours. Comfort Zone’s® Digital Electric oil filled radiator heater is permanently sealed and never needs refueling. Did not find the description to be complete
Based on what I read, I thought this heater had a programmable timer that would allow me to set it to come on every morning at a given time and then shut offin a couple hours. The timer function is an extremely primitive couontdown timer that only allows you to set 1-10 hours before it turns on or 1-10 hours before it shuts off. You cannot have both active and you cannot set a clock timer for on or off. It works well enough, the description was just not complete and was a tad misleading.
